Transaction 3165622fc43894041459967597fa7121204e6d01a1e565f9cac24c064af919c8
1 Input
1 Output
-
3165622fc43894041459967597fa7121204e6d01a1e565f9cac24c064af919c8:0
- value
- 1198000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 877d2d796c6938b5853c088dbbf86eed1e5bd495 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MQBPiL67Q3ABRGePVZ487ryJ5uYGxZhj